7.About 8pin 6pin power connector production equipment
Power connector production equipment is used to manufacture power connectors for a variety of applications. This equipment is used to create a variety of power connectors, including those used in automotive, industrial, and consumer electronics. The equipment typically includes a variety of machines, such as presses, injection molding machines, and die-casting machines. The machines are used to create the various components of the power connectors, such as the contacts, housings, and terminals. The equipment is also used to assemble the components into the finished product.

11.Are there any options for tool-less installation of 8pin 6pin power connectors?
Yes, there are several options for tool-less installation of power connectors. These include push-in connectors, twist-lock connectors, and snap-in connectors. Push-in connectors are the most common type of tool-less power connector and are designed to be inserted into a power socket without the need for any tools. Twist-lock connectors are also available and are designed to be twisted into place. Finally, snap-in connectors are designed to be snapped into place without the need for any tools.

13.What are the main components of a 8pin 6pin power connector?
We are a professional 8pin 6pin power connector company dedicated to providing high quality products and services. The main components of a power connector are the housing, contacts, and strain relief. The housing is the outer shell of the connector that holds the contacts and strain relief in place. The contacts are the electrical terminals that make contact with the mating connector. The strain relief is a flexible material that helps to secure the cable to the connector and prevents it from being pulled out.
